1. Safety Vulnerabilities
Unauthorized modifications of Android utility packages (APKs) introduce vital safety vulnerabilities that may compromise machine integrity and person information. These modifications, typically pursued to avoid licensing or acquire unfair benefits in purposes, concurrently open avenues for malicious code injection and information breaches.
-
Code Injection Dangers
Modified APKs can comprise injected malicious code. This code, absent within the unique utility, would possibly execute arbitrary instructions, steal delicate data (passwords, monetary information), or set up additional malware. The person, unaware of the altered code, grants the modified utility the permissions it requests, inadvertently offering entry to delicate areas of the system.
-
Bypassing Safety Checks
Respectable purposes incorporate safety checks to forestall tampering and shield person information. Modifications typically contain disabling or bypassing these checks, rendering the applying weak to assaults. For instance, a safety examine supposed to confirm the applying’s integrity is perhaps eliminated, permitting an attacker to change the applying’s information information with out detection.
-
Outdated Libraries and Dependencies
Modified purposes are steadily based mostly on outdated variations of the unique utility. These older variations could comprise recognized safety vulnerabilities which were patched in newer releases. Through the use of a modified utility, customers expose themselves to those vulnerabilities, which could be exploited by attackers to achieve management of the machine.
-
Compromised Digital Signatures
Android purposes are digitally signed by their builders to confirm authenticity and integrity. Modifications invalidate this signature, making it unattainable to confirm that the applying originates from a trusted supply. The absence of a legitimate digital signature will increase the danger of putting in a malicious utility masquerading as a authentic one.
The vulnerabilities inherent in modified APKs symbolize a critical menace to Android machine safety. These dangers vary from code injection and bypassed safety checks to outdated libraries and compromised digital signatures. Subsequently, acquiring purposes from official sources and verifying their integrity stays paramount in mitigating potential safety compromises.

3. Malware distribution
The distribution of malware represents a major threat related to unauthorized modifications of Android utility packages (APKs). Modified APKs, typically obtained from unofficial sources, steadily function vectors for distributing malicious software program, posing a menace to machine safety and person information.
-
Trojanized Purposes
Malware distributors typically repackage authentic purposes with malicious code, creating Trojanized variations. Customers who obtain and set up these modified APKs inadvertently set up the malware alongside the supposed utility. The malicious code can carry out varied actions, reminiscent of stealing delicate data, displaying undesirable ads, or putting in further malware. For instance, a well-liked recreation is perhaps modified to incorporate a keylogger that information person keystrokes, together with passwords and monetary particulars. The modified APK, showing because the authentic recreation, then distributes the keylogger to unsuspecting customers.
-
Hidden Backdoors and Exploits
Modified APKs can comprise hidden backdoors and exploits that permit attackers to remotely management the compromised machine. These backdoors can be utilized to entry delicate information, monitor person exercise, and even take full management of the machine. An instance is a modified system utility utility that features a backdoor permitting distant entry by the attacker. As soon as put in, the attacker can use the backdoor to put in additional malware, entry information, or management the machine’s digicam and microphone.
-
Drive-by Downloads and Malvertising
Web sites that host modified APKs typically make use of drive-by downloads and malvertising methods to distribute malware. Drive-by downloads happen when an internet site mechanically downloads and installs malware onto a person’s machine with out their express consent. Malvertising includes embedding malicious ads inside authentic web sites, which redirect customers to malicious web sites or set off the obtain of malware. Within the context of modified APKs, an internet site providing a modified model of an utility would possibly use drive-by downloads to put in further malware when the person makes an attempt to obtain the APK, or malicious ads would possibly redirect customers to web sites internet hosting malware.
-
Social Engineering and Misleading Practices
Malware distributors steadily use social engineering and misleading practices to trick customers into putting in modified APKs containing malware. These techniques embody creating faux web sites that mimic authentic utility shops, utilizing engaging descriptions to lure customers into downloading malicious purposes, and impersonating authentic builders or firms. For instance, a malware distributor would possibly create an internet site that appears similar to the Google Play Retailer and supply a modified model of a well-liked utility with guarantees of free premium options. Unsuspecting customers would possibly obtain and set up the modified APK, unaware that it incorporates malware.
The connection between modified APKs and malware distribution underscores the significance of acquiring purposes from official sources, verifying utility integrity, and exercising warning when downloading and putting in software program from untrusted sources. The dangers related to malware distribution by way of modified APKs vary from information theft and machine compromise to monetary loss and id theft, highlighting the necessity for heightened consciousness and safety practices.

6. Authorized repercussions
The modification and distribution of Android utility packages (APKs) with out authorization carries vital authorized ramifications. These actions violate a number of mental property legal guidelines and might expose people to substantial authorized dangers. The results vary from civil lawsuits to legal fees, relying on the severity and nature of the infringement.
-
Copyright Infringement and Civil Lawsuits
Altering an utility’s code and distributing it constitutes copyright infringement, because it creates an unauthorized by-product work. Copyright holders possess the unique proper to manage the copy, distribution, and modification of their copyrighted works. Participating in these actions with out permission topics the infringing celebration to civil lawsuits. Penalties can embody financial damages to compensate the copyright holder for losses suffered on account of the infringement, in addition to authorized charges. The extent of damages awarded typically relies on components such because the extent of the infringement and whether or not it was willful. Corporations actively monitor for unauthorized modifications and vigorously pursue authorized motion in opposition to infringers to guard their mental property rights.
-
Circumvention of Technological Safety Measures (TPMs) and the DMCA
Purposes typically make use of technological safety measures to forestall unauthorized entry, copying, and distribution. Circumventing these measures, reminiscent of license verification methods or encryption, violates legal guidelines just like the Digital Millennium Copyright Act (DMCA) in the US. The DMCA prohibits the act of circumventing technological measures that management entry to copyrighted works. Violations can lead to each civil and legal penalties, together with fines and imprisonment. Modifying purposes to bypass license checks, for instance, constitutes a violation of the DMCA and might result in authorized motion.
-
Distribution of Malware and Prison Expenses
When modified APKs comprise malware or are used to distribute malicious software program, people concerned can face legal fees associated to laptop fraud and abuse. These fees can carry vital penalties, together with prolonged jail sentences and substantial fines. Moreover, people who distribute modified APKs that deliberately harm or disrupt laptop methods may additionally face legal fees underneath legal guidelines prohibiting such actions. The severity of the penalties typically relies on the extent of the harm triggered and the intent of the person distributing the malware.
-
Violation of Phrases of Service and Contractual Agreements
Most purposes are ruled by phrases of service (TOS) or end-user license agreements (EULAs) that prohibit modification or unauthorized use of the software program. Modifying an utility and distributing it may well violate these agreements, probably resulting in authorized motion for breach of contract. Whereas the penalties for breach of contract are usually much less extreme than these for copyright infringement or legal fees, they’ll nonetheless end in monetary damages and authorized charges. Corporations typically embody clauses of their TOS or EULA that explicitly prohibit modification of their software program, and violations of those clauses can result in authorized motion.

Mitigating Dangers Related to Unverified Android Modifications
The next tips present methods for decreasing publicity to potential threats when coping with unverified Android utility modifications. The following tips give attention to knowledgeable decision-making and proactive safety measures.
Tip 1: Prioritize Official Utility Shops: The first methodology of minimizing threat includes sourcing purposes solely from official utility shops, reminiscent of Google Play Retailer. These platforms implement safety protocols and conduct vetting processes aimed toward figuring out and eradicating malicious purposes. Though not infallible, they supply a considerably safer surroundings in comparison with unofficial sources.
Tip 2: Scrutinize Utility Permissions: Earlier than putting in any utility, completely overview the requested permissions. Purposes requesting entry to delicate information or system capabilities and not using a clear justification warrant heightened scrutiny. Granting pointless permissions will increase the potential for misuse of non-public data.
Tip 3: Make use of Antivirus Software program: Implementing a good antivirus answer designed for Android units presents an extra layer of safety. These purposes can scan put in purposes and downloaded information for recognized malware signatures, offering early detection and mitigation of potential threats.
Tip 4: Allow “Confirm Apps” Characteristic: Android working methods embody a “Confirm Apps” function that scans purposes from unknown sources earlier than set up. Making certain this function is enabled gives a baseline stage of safety in opposition to probably dangerous purposes.
Tip 5: Keep Software program Updates: Usually updating the Android working system and put in purposes is essential for patching safety vulnerabilities. Software program updates typically embody fixes for recognized exploits, decreasing the danger of compromise by malicious purposes.
Tip 6: Train Warning with Rooted Units: Rooting an Android machine removes manufacturer-imposed restrictions, granting larger management over the working system. Nonetheless, rooting additionally will increase the machine’s vulnerability to safety threats. Proceed with warning and solely root units when completely mandatory, as this bypasses vital safety safeguards.
Tip 7: Implement Community Monitoring: Using community monitoring instruments might help establish uncommon community exercise originating from put in purposes. Monitoring community visitors can reveal situations the place purposes are transmitting information to unauthorized servers, indicating potential malicious conduct.
